It's that Make Dizziness When to Use New Glasses


Some people sometimes feel dizzy or uncomfortable when I have to wear a new pair well with the recipe (minus or plus) new or not. How come?

"If a new eyeglass prescription bit more powerful than the old one, it might take some adaptation," said Michael J Wojciak, OD, an optometrist in Schaumburg, Illinois, as quoted from Allexpert.com,

Dr Wojciak said that usually a person in need of adaptation to this new eyeglasses about 7 days or more, but if there is no improvement and continued to feel dizzy then there is a possibility of prescription glasses is not accurate.

As for patients who have astigmatism, the lens shapes and materials used plays a big role in this adaptation process. The lens type usually require adaptation polycarb longer for patients cylindrical.

This condition mainly occurs in patients who have a prescription cylindrical -1.5 or more. As well as eyeglass frames that are too wide can also trigger the onset of discomfort during this adaptation process.

Besides other things that could be the trigger is the wrong prescription glasses or less right. This condition is caused by a swollen eye conditions when conducting the examination, or as a result of prescription minus or plusnya improper with eye conditions (usually followed by blurred vision or ghosting).

Use of the wrong prescription glasses can exacerbate eye conditions such as minus or plus the increase if not promptly corrected, as well as the difficulty in driving or inhibiting activity.

American Optometric Association recommends to remove the glasses for a moment when it feels dizziness or headache, and put it on again when the dizziness is gone. Also try rotating the head and not the eye when using a lens bifocals or trifocals, because it takes practice.
